Malteser International (MI) is the international humanitarian relief agency of the Sovereign Order of Malta. For over 60 years we provide relief and recovery for people during and following conflicts and disasters around the world. Christian values and humanitarian principles form the foundations of our work. In over 30 countries in Africa, the Americas, Asia, Europe and the Middle East, we support people in need – regardless of their religion, origin or political convictions.

In the Middle East Region, MI is operating in the context of the humanitarian crisis in Syria since 2012 implementing emergency relief measures in Turkey, Syria, and Lebanon and since 2014 in Iraq. Malteser International’s programs cover needs mainly in the health sector and are mostly partner implemented. In Lebanon, Malteser International works in partnership with the “Order of Malta Lebanon (OML)” to implement a multi-annual program funded by the German Federal Foreign Office (GFFO) to strengthen health, social and agro- humanitarian services provided by OML across Lebanon.
